Cloverleaf Residents Step Back in Time at the Museum of Lincolnshire Life

Residents recently embarked on another exciting Myley Tours adventure – this time choosing to visit the Museum of Lincolnshire Life, a fascinating celebration of Lincolnshire’s rich culture and heritage dating back to 1750.

The museum’s exhibits beautifully capture the essence of local history, showcasing life through the centuries – from commerce and domestic living to agriculture, industry, and community traditions. Residents thoroughly enjoyed exploring the recreated period rooms, discovering how people once lived and worked, and reminiscing about times gone by.

Highlights of the visit included stepping inside an old-fashioned classroom, complete with wooden desks, and exploring the museum’s impressive military displays. The group was particularly captivated by the First World War trench experience, featuring flashing lights, sound effects, and realistic narration that brought history vividly to life.

The collection of historic vehicles – including tanks, trains, and tractors – also proved to be a firm favourite. As they moved through the exhibits, many residents shared memories of how their grandparents once used similar tools and equipment in the kitchen and laundry room, sparking meaningful conversations and nostalgia.

To round off a wonderful day, everyone gathered in the museum café, where a coffee morning in support of St Barnabas Hospice was taking place. Residents enjoyed a delightful selection of homemade cakes, including lemon drizzle, fruit cake, and Victoria sponge – the perfect end to a day filled with discovery, conversation, and community spirit.
